2. Informații de siguranță
Always observe the following safety precautions to prevent injury and avoid damage to the instrument or the equipment under test.
- Nu utilizați dispozitivul dacă pare deteriorat sau dacă izolația cablurilor de testare este compromisă.
- Asigurați-vă că ați selectat funcția și intervalul corect înainte de a efectua orice măsurătoare.
- Nu depășiți limitele maxime de intrare pentru nicio funcție.
- Fiți extrem de precauți când lucrați cu voltagpeste 30V AC RMS, 42V peak sau 60V DC. Aceste voltajetagreprezintă un pericol de șoc.
- Disconnect power to the circuit and discharge all high-voltagcondensatoarele înainte de a efectua teste de rezistență, continuitate sau diode.
- Use only the test leads provided or approved by Hcalory.
- Țineți degetele în spatele apărătorilor de degete de pe sondele de testare în timpul utilizării.
- Do not operate the device in explosive gas, vapor, or dust environments.

6.2.1 Îmbunătățirea rezoluției TISR
The Hcalory TS-M features TISR (Thermal Imaging Super Resolution) technology, enhancing the thermal image resolution to 240x240 pixels for greater clarity. This feature can typically be toggled on or off via the device's menu settings to suit different inspection needs.

Figure 6.2: TISR Resolution Comparison
This image demonstrates the impact of TISR technology. On the left, a thermal image with TISR enabled shows a resolution of 240x240, providing significantly more detail. On the right, the same scene with TISR off displays a lower resolution of 64x64, highlighting the clarity improvement offered by the enhanced resolution feature.

6.3.1 Common Multimeter Functions:
- VoltagMăsurare (AC/DC): Connect probes in parallel with the component or circuit to measure voltage.
- Măsurarea rezistenței: Ensure the circuit is de-energized. Connect probes across the component to measure resistance.
- Test de continuitate: For checking if a circuit is complete. The device will typically emit an audible tone if continuity is detected.
- Test de diodă: For checking the functionality of diodes.
7. Întreținere
7.1 Curățare
Ștergeți dispozitivul casing cu anunțamp cloth and mild detergent. Do not use abrasive cleaners or solvents. Ensure the device is powered off and disconnected from any power source before cleaning. Do not immerse the device in water.
7.2 Îngrijirea bateriei
The device contains a rechargeable lithium-ion battery. For optimal battery life, avoid fully discharging the battery frequently. If storing the device for an extended period, charge it to approximately 50% every few months.
7.3 Fuse Replacement (Multimeter)
The multimeter functions are protected by internal fuses. If a current measurement function fails, the fuse may need replacement. Refer to the specifications for the correct fuse type and rating. Fuse replacement should only be performed by qualified personnel.
